Phylogenetic Relationships of Aracanin Genera of Boxfishes (Ostraciidae: Tetraodontiformes)

Abstract
A cladistic analysis of the external characters, osteology and myology of the seven genera currently assigned to the ostraciid (trunkfishes and boxfishes) subfamily Aracaninae (boxfishes) results in our proposal of its division into two tribes, the Aracanini (Aracana, Strophiurichthys, Anoplocapros, Caprichthys and Capropygia) and the Kentrocaprini (Kentrocapros and Polyplacapros). In the case of the Aracanini, the phylogeny can be derived from the classification either from sequencing or from the numerical suffix method. Evidence is presented which corroborates the hypotheses that: a) the Aracaninae is monophyletic; b) the Ostraciinae is monophyletic; c) the Aracaninae and Ostraciinae are sister groups (the Ostraciidae); d) the Balistidae is monophyletic; and e) the Balistidae and Ostraciidae are sister groups.
